In a medium-sized mixing bowl, whisk together the all-purpose flour, cornstarch, baking powder, salt, ground black pepper, garlic powder, and paprika until well combined.
Crack the egg into a separate small bowl and whisk it lightly until the yolk and white are blended.
Add the whisked egg to the dry ingredients and start mixing gently.
Gradually pour in the cold sparkling water while stirring, until the batter reaches a smooth and slightly thick consistency. Be careful not to overmix; a few lumps are okay.
Prepare the zucchini by slicing it into even rounds or sticks, about 1/4-inch thick.
Dip each zucchini slice into the batter, ensuring it is fully coated.
In a deep skillet or frying pan, heat about an inch of vegetable oil over medium-high heat until it reaches 350°F (175°C).
Fry the battered zucchini slices in small batches, for about 2-3 minutes per side, or until golden and crispy.
Remove the fried zucchini from the oil with a slotted spoon and place them on a plate lined with paper towels to drain excess oil.
Serve immediately with your favorite dipping sauce or garnish with a sprinkle of fresh herbs for added flavor.
